其他题名 | Experimental research on velocity measurement based on microwave modulated laser technologies |
中文摘要 | 为了验证微波调制激光技术进行速度测量的可靠性,构建了一套通过微波调制激光技术测速的实验系统。利用激光作为载波,微波作为模拟调制信号对激光信号进行强度调制,光电探测器对信号光强度进行直接探测。利用射频电路,获得多普勒频移数据反演发射端和接收端相对运动速度。同时通过测量运动距离和时间计算平均运动速度,作为第三方数据,用于与微波调制激光技术测速的数据进行比较。理论分析了这套系统的原理并对其进行了实验验证。实验结果表明,利用微波调制激光技术测速的数据与第三方数据平均偏差小于2.0%,符合性好。 |
英文摘要 | In order to verify the reliability of the velocity measurement by microwave modulated laser technologies, a system of microwave modulated laser velocity measurement was developed. In the system, laser as carrier was intensity-modulated by microwave signal, transmitted the signal intensity was directly detected by the receiver on a movement platform. After the signal processing, the Doppler frequency shift data was obtained, from which the relative velocity was obtained. Meanwhile, the average velocity as the third party data was calculated by measurements of the movement distance and time, which was used to compare with velocities calculated by Doppler shift. The theoretical analysis and verification experiment are presented and the results show that the velocities calculated by Doppler shift are in good agreement with the third party velocities with a mean deviation of 2.0%. |
